Improving Air Quality
One of the most significant benefits of having indoor plants is their ability to purify the air. Many plants, such as snake plants, peace lilies, and spider plants, are known for their ability to absorb harmful toxins like benzene, formaldehyde, and xylene, which are often found in household items like furniture, paints, and cleaning products. By buying home plants, individuals can create a healthier living environment.
Boosting Mood and Productivity
Indoor plants have been shown to have a positive impact on mental health and productivity. Studies have found that having plants in the workplace can reduce stress levels, improve concentration, and increase overall job satisfaction. Similarly, at home, plants can create a more calming and inviting atmosphere, which can lead to a better mood and a more efficient work-from-home setup.

Types of Home Plants
The market for buy home plants is vast and varied, offering something for every taste and space. Here are some popular types of indoor plants:
Easy-to-Care-for Plants
For those who may not have a green thumb, there are many low-maintenance plants that are perfect for beginners. These include:
- Snake plants (Sansevieria)
- Spider plants (Chlorophytum comosum)
- Peace lilies (Spathiphyllum)
- ZZ plants (Zamioculcas zamiifolia)
Decorative Plants
For those looking to add a touch of style to their home, there are several decorative plants that can make a statement:
- Bamboo (Bambusa spp.)
- Orchids (Orchidaceae family)
- Bonsai trees
- Philodendrons
Tropical Plants
Tropical plants can bring a sense of the exotic to any room. Some popular options include:
- Monstera deliciosa (Swiss cheese plant)
- Calathea (Prayer plant)
- Begonias
- Fiddle leaf fig (Ficus lyrata)
Caring for Your Home Plants
While buying home plants is exciting, it's important to understand how to care for them properly to ensure their longevity and health.
Light Requirements
Most plants need a certain amount of light to thrive, but the amount can vary greatly. It's essential to research the specific light requirements of each plant and position them accordingly. Some plants can tolerate low light, while others need bright, indirect sunlight.
Watering Schedule
Overwatering is a common issue with indoor plants, so it's crucial to find the right balance. The frequency of watering will depend on the type of plant, the size of the pot, and the climate. Generally, it's best to water plants when the top inch of soil feels dry to the touch.
Humidity and Temperature
Some plants prefer higher humidity, while others thrive in cooler temperatures. It's important to create an environment that meets the specific needs of your plants. Using a humidifier or placing plants in bathrooms with higher humidity can be beneficial for certain species.
Feeding and Pruning
Plants need nutrients to grow, so it's important to fertilize them according to their needs. Most plants benefit from a balanced, water-soluble fertilizer applied every few weeks during the growing season. Pruning is also important to maintain the shape and health of your plants.
